Broccoli & Sweet Potato Mash

A vibrant and mild-tasting mash that introduces your baby to the earthy flavor of broccoli softened by the natural sweetness of sweet potato. High in fiber and Vitamin C.
Ingredients
- 1 medium Sweet Potato
- 100 grams Broccoli
Instructions
- Wash, peel, and dice the sweet potato into small cubes.
- Wash the broccoli and cut it into small florets, removing any tough parts of the stem.
- Place the sweet potato cubes in a steamer basket over boiling water. Cover and steam for 10 minutes.
- Add the broccoli florets to the steamer and continue steaming for another 5-7 minutes, or until both are very tender when pierced with a fork.
- Transfer the vegetables to a bowl. For a 6-month-old, use a blender to create a completely smooth puree.
- As your baby gets older, you can transition to using a fork to create a 'textured mash' instead of a smooth puree.
- Add 1-2 tablespoons of breast milk, formula, or the steaming water to reach the desired consistency.
- Stir in a half-teaspoon of extra virgin olive oil to help your baby absorb the fat-soluble vitamins.
